Palamax Betting and Gaming
12 Gough Square, 3rd Floor, London, Buckinghamshire, England EC4A 3DW, United Kingdom
Palamax Betting and Gaming Ltd was a London-based company operating in the gambling technology sector, incorporated in 2006 as Betforce Limited and renamed in 2009. The firm positioned itself as a software provider for sportsbook platforms and a publisher of casino and gaming business data, offering custom games with a claim of no monthly fees. However, the company was dissolved on 1 August 2017, and its website at palamax.com no longer resolves to an active site. The only verifiable legal records come from UK Companies House, which shows its last registered address at 12 Gough Square, London, and its last accounts filed up to February 2016. Despite directory listings describing it as a leading provider, there is no evidence of any current or recent operations, clients, or market presence. The entity appears to have been a small-scale operation that ceased trading nearly a decade ago, leaving behind minimal public footprint beyond regulatory filings and a single vendor profile.

Orion InfoSolutions
Jaipur, India
Orion InfoSolutions is a Jaipur, India-headquartered IT solutions provider specializing in mobile app development, game development, web development, and digital marketing. Founded in 2014, the company has built a reputation for crafting immersive 2D/3D games for multiple platforms, including mobile, PC, web, NFT, and metaverse. It also offers cross-platform app development using React Native and Flutter, e-commerce solutions via Magento and WordPress, and modern JavaScript frameworks. The company explicitly states it does not provide real-money gaming or gambling services in India, complying with the IT Act 2000 and the Promotion & Regulation of Online Gaming Bill 2025. Instead, it focuses on skill-based games and social casino templates for markets outside India. With a team size reported between 40 and 80 employees, Orion InfoSolutions serves a global client base from its single office in Jaipur, emphasizing agile development and round-the-clock support. It claims over 970 happy clients and 2,600 completed projects across 12 years of operation.
OptimaMGS
Seville, Spain
OptimaMGS is a B2B provider of omnichannel sports betting and iGaming technology, operating as a brand of Sportradar since its acquisition in 2017. Founded in 2012 and headquartered in Seville, Spain, the company delivers a modular, scalable platform suite designed for regulated operators worldwide. Its flagship OPTIMAMGS™ platform is an award-winning system capable of processing billions of transactions annually and powers major operators such as Betfred, Unibet, and Norsk Tipping. The company holds certifications from the Malta Gaming Authority, UK Gambling Commission, Gibraltar Gambling Commissioner, and other regulators, positioning it as a trusted partner in high-volume, regulated markets. As part of Sportradar, OptimaMGS integrates with Sportradar’s global data and risk management services, offering operators a unified one-stop-shop solution. The company employs a small but agile team of approximately 21–50 people, focusing on future-proof architecture and personalized service.

OneTouch Games
Tallinn, Estonia (with additional offices in Ukraine, Spain, Malta, Manila; LinkedIn lists headquarters as Douglas, Isle of Man)
OneTouch is a mobile-first online casino games developer established in 2015. The company identifies a gap in the market for premium-quality mobile table games and has since built a portfolio spanning slots, table games, and live dealer offerings. Its design philosophy centres on single-touch interactivity and flawless performance across both handheld and desktop devices. OneTouch's content is particularly popular in Far-Eastern and European markets, with additional presence in Africa and Latin America. The studio operates from a head office in Tallinn, Estonia, with additional offices in Ukraine, Spain, Malta, and Manila. According to its LinkedIn profile, the company employs 11–50 people and is privately held. In recent years, OneTouch has focused on expanding its live games vertical and securing distribution partnerships with aggregators such as Revolver Gaming and SoftSwiss. The company's website, onetouch.io, showcases a game library that includes titles like *Royal Riches Roulette*, *Bombay Blackjack*, *Bombay Roulette*, and *Teen Patti*, along with a 'Pay Anywhere' slot mechanic featured in its latest release, *Ancient Triton*.

Omega Systems
Reading, Pennsylvania, United States
Omega Systems is a multi-award-winning managed service provider (MSP) and managed security service provider (MSSP) headquartered in Reading, Pennsylvania. Founded in 2002 by Bill and Jen Kiritsis, the company delivers fully managed IT, cybersecurity, and compliance solutions to mid-market and enterprise organizations in highly regulated industries, including healthcare, financial services, manufacturing, government, and professional services. Omega Systems’ portfolio encompasses 24×7 managed IT support, managed detection and response (MDR), backup and disaster recovery, multi-cloud connectivity, and compliance advisory services. The company operates its own SOC 2‑certified cloud platform and data center, meeting stringent security and regulatory requirements such as HIPAA, GLBA, and CJIS. Over the past decade, Omega Systems has experienced consistent revenue growth, reaching an estimated $95.4M in annual revenue as of 2024, and has been recognized repeatedly on industry lists including the CRN Solution Provider 500, CRN Tech Elite 250, Inc. 5000, and the Channel Futures MSP 501. In 2023, the company transitioned day‑to‑day leadership to Mike Fuhrman (CEO) and Ben Tercha (COO), while co‑founders moved to advisory roles. Omega Systems has completed multiple acquisitions and in early 2025 received a strategic investment from Revelstoke Capital Partners to accelerate geographic expansion.

ONEworks Limited
Castletown, Isle of Man
ONEworks Limited is a privately held sportsbook software provider headquartered in Castletown, Isle of Man, with a registered presence in the United Kingdom. Founded in 2000, the company specializes in the development and delivery of customizable sports-betting platforms and turnkey wagering solutions. Its core product, the ONEbook platform, has been refined for over a decade and offers extensive pre-match and in-play markets, including over 5,000 soccer events and 18,000 markets. ONEworks serves licensed operators targeting international, European, and Asian markets, and provides integration services for third-party or proprietary systems. The company’s headcount is disputed: LinkedIn reports 51-200 employees, while RocketReach reports 22 and Companies House micro-company accounts imply fewer than 10 for the registered entity. Despite the size uncertainty, ONEworks positions itself as a flexible technology partner with a client base spanning multiple regions and a reputation for timely delivery and strong support.

OneAdvanced
Birmingham, West Midlands, United Kingdom
OneAdvanced Group Limited is a British private enterprise software and cloud computing company headquartered in Birmingham, UK. Founded in 2008 by Vin Murria, the company supplies business software and outsourced IT services to organisations in highly regulated sectors including health and social care, education, legal services, social housing, distribution and logistics, government, and commercial services. Originally listed on AIM as Advanced Computer Software, it was taken private by Vista Equity Partners in 2014 and later sold a 50% stake to BC Partners in 2019, with both firms now jointly owning the business. After a 2023 strategy refresh, the company rebranded to OneAdvanced and launched its 'Intelligent System of Work' platform that embeds AI, data analytics, and common services into customer operations. OneAdvanced employs around 2,900 people and serves millions of end-users daily, including managing 1.5 million NHS 111 calls per month and supporting over 2 million learners. In January 2024, it sold its application modernisation division to IBM. The company reported revenue of £346 million in 2024.

OMI Gaming
Sweden
OMI Gaming is a Swedish video slot studio founded in 2017 that pivoted from a development consultancy to a dedicated in-house game developer by late 2017. The company focuses on creating high-end, triple-A mobile and multi-platform casino games with solid mathematical modelling, embodied in its tagline “Proper games, solid maths.” Its portfolio includes three confirmed titles—Polar Wilds™, Lucky For You™, and The Cheshire Tree™—each featuring innovative mechanics such as Arctic Circles, supermeter games, row expansions, and high volatility. The studio is privately held and led by founder and CEO André Orefjärd. No licensing jurisdictions, partnerships, or funding rounds have been publicly disclosed, and headcount remains unknown, suggesting a small, early-stage operation. The company’s online footprint is minimal, with only its official website and a single startup listing providing verifiable information.

ODDSworks Inc.
Downers Grove, Illinois, USA
ODDSworks Inc. is a privately held iGaming technology company based in Downers Grove, Illinois, founded in 2020 by Shridhar Joshi. The company specializes in Remote Gaming Server (RGS) technology and interactive content for regulated online gambling markets across North America. Its core platform, BETguard, is a certified game server that supports progressive jackpots, free spins, and bonusing tools, while the O-Connect aggregation layer enables distribution of proprietary and third-party games. ODDSworks’ game portfolio includes video slots, video poker, table games, and scratch-offs. The company has secured licenses in Connecticut, New Jersey, Michigan, Pennsylvania, West Virginia, Ontario, and Quebec, and has formed partnerships with major operators such as Caesars Entertainment and FanDuel. With over 100 years of combined gaming experience among its leadership, ODDSworks raised approximately $2.4 million in seed funding as of 2025. The company continues to expand its North American footprint through strategic partnerships and technology innovation.

Old Skool Studios
North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ada
Old Skool Studios is a Canadian slot game developer founded in 2009 and headquartered in North Vancouver, British Columbia. The studio operates exclusively as a content partner to Games Global, distributing its premium video slot titles through that aggregation platform to tier‑1 online casino operators worldwide. Its portfolio is built around feature‑rich slots with distinctive themes, often inspired by retro aesthetics and pop culture. Notable games include Jokerizer, Rise of the Dead, and Mystic Joker. Despite being active since 2009, the company maintains an unusually low public profile — it has no accessible website, no confirmed leadership publicly listed, and only minimal social media presence. The studio’s games are built on HTML5, certified for regulated markets like the UK and Malta, and typically offer return‑to‑player rates between 96% and 97%. The team is believed to be small, typical of a specialised content studio, and the business relies entirely on its exclusive distribution deal with Games Global to reach operators such as LeoVegas and 888casino.
